亚马孙VPS搭建指南
卡尔云官网
www.kaeryun.com
在当今数字化浪潮中,拥有一个稳定且安全的服务器环境对于任何在线业务都至关重要,而亚马孙VPS(AWS Virtual Private Server, abbreviated as AWS VPS)作为一个经济实惠的云服务器解决方案,成为许多创业者和小型企业实现本地化部署的理想选择,本文将为你详细讲解如何从零开始搭建一个亚马孙VPS服务器,确保你能够轻松掌握这一技能。
什么是亚马孙VPS?
亚马孙VPS是指亚马逊云计算服务(Amazon Web Services, AWS)提供的虚拟专用服务器(VPS)服务,与传统的物理服务器不同,VPS是一种虚拟化服务,用户可以按需租用资源,按需扩展,同时享受与物理服务器相似的性能和稳定性,亚马孙VPS的价格通常比整台物理服务器便宜,但比个人虚拟机贵,适合个人开发者和小型企业。
搭建亚马孙VPS的步骤
注册和登录AWS账号
搭建亚马孙VPS的第一步是注册并登录AWS账号,访问AWS官方网站,选择适合的定价模型(如按需付费或长期订阅),然后按照提示完成注册流程,注册完成后,登录你的AWS账户,进入主控制台。
选择VPS套餐
在AWS主控制台中,进入“Compute”部分,选择“Launch Instance”开始创建新虚拟机,这里会显示多种VPS套餐选项,包括不同的计算资源(CPU、内存)、存储资源(SSD)、存储扩展(如ElasticBlock Cloud)、网络配置(带宽、防火墙)以及存储扩展(如Elastic File System),根据你的需求选择合适的套餐,如果你只需要简单的网站托管,可以选择一个中等大小的VPS套餐。
安装操作系统
在AWS控制台中,选择好VPS套餐后,点击“Launch Instance”按钮,系统会自动下载并安装操作系统,安装完成后,你会收到一封来自AWS的确认邮件,按照邮件中的指示,点击链接完成安装。
配置VPS
安装完成后,进入“VPC”部分,配置VPS的网络设置,这里可以设置VPS的公私钥、防火墙规则、网络接口等,完成配置后,VPS就会自动启动。
安装Web服务器
在“Compute”部分,进入“Web服务器”页面,选择一个合适的Web服务器,如Apache或Nginx,安装完成后,进入“Security”部分,配置Web服务器的安全设置,包括启用SSL证书、设置安全组等。
搭建网站
在“Storage”部分,选择一个合适的存储解决方案,如Elastic File System(EFS)或S3,安装完成后,进入“Elastic File System”页面,创建一个存储空间,在“Web服务器”页面,配置域名和DNS记录,完成网站的搭建。
配置数据库
在“Database”部分,选择一个合适的数据库,如MySQL或PostgreSQL,安装完成后,配置数据库的端口、端口范围、访问规则等。
安全配置
在“Security”部分,配置VPS的安全设置,这包括设置安全组,限制外网的访问,启用安全软件,如OWASP ZAP,以及配置SSSL证书。
监控和维护
在“Monitoring”部分,配置VPS的监控设置,这包括设置监控日志、设置警告邮件等,定期备份数据,监控服务器状态,确保VPS的稳定运行。
部署测试
在确认所有配置完成后,可以进行一次部署测试,访问VPS的域名,检查网站是否正常加载,数据库是否正常连接,确保一切正常后,就可以正式投入运营了。
注意事项
-
成本控制:/aws VPS的价格比整台物理服务器便宜,但比个人虚拟机贵,合理规划资源使用,避免不必要的资源浪费。
-
安全性:亚马孙VPS的默认配置已经非常安全,但为了进一步保护你的数据,建议配置SSSL证书,启用安全软件,并定期进行安全审计。
-
监控:定期监控VPS的运行状态,包括CPU、内存、带宽等指标,确保服务器的稳定运行。
-
备份:定期备份数据,避免数据丢失,使用EFS或S3等存储服务,可以方便地进行数据备份和恢复。
-
学习资源: AWS的官方文档非常详细,是学习和参考的最佳资源,有很多在线教程和社区可以提供帮助和支持。
亚马孙VPS搭建是一个相对复杂的过程,但只要按照步骤来, carefully配置和维护,你就可以轻松掌握这项技能,从注册账号到配置网络,从安装操作系统到搭建网站,每一个环节都需要仔细操作,合理规划资源使用,关注服务器的安全和监控,可以确保你的VPS长期稳定运行,希望本文的指导能够帮助你顺利完成亚马孙VPS的搭建,为你的在线业务提供坚实的后盾支持。
卡尔云官网
www.kaeryun.com